Nothing terribly original here, just a method that worked out once so maybe it will next time also ...
1 large zucchini, grated
place on paper towel, sprinkle with salt, let sit 2 min, add towel on top and press to extract some water
mix 1/4 c cornmeal and 1/2 c white flour, 1 tsp baking soda, another pinch salt, any desired herbs. toss the zucchini in this dry mixture to coat
beat 2 egg whites till frothy, add 2 Tbs olive or canola oil and continue beating, then mix half into zukes and fold in other half
form mixture into patties, using a little extra flour/cornmeal to coat your hands if needed, and drop into pre-heated cast iron skillet to shallow fry in garlic butter or garlic oil till crisp each side
I like serving it topped with an herbed white bean salad or a fried egg and fresh greens.
